Cyberphobe

Cyberphobe picture by Cyberphobe

Cyberphobe is an experimental unit that uses lo-fi techniques with op-shop electronics to blend electronic drone, pulse, noise, found sound, samples, plunder, and free-form keyboards. I'm currently working on drone and pulse based pieces using an old Esoniq SQ-80 coupled to a guitar effects unit, and I'm also experimenting with found sound collages, using a 4-track to blend material lifted from various media (CDs, radio, whatever) as well as sounds captured on a small portable cassette recorder. Haven't much finished product to describe yet, just a few fragments involving animal sounds, human voice, electronics, and found sounds. (more info)

Free Speech for Sale
Advertising is a pervasive and powerful force throughout mass media. A group of experimental audio artists who call themselves Snuggles has collaborated over the Internet to compile Free Speech For Sale, an audio collage art-response to the oversaturation of corporate advertising within the mass media.
